can you help? Find the distance between A(8,3) and B(9,0) to the nearest hundredth.​

Respuesta :

adelodunoba85
adelodunoba85 adelodunoba85
  • 03-12-2019

Answer:

3.16

Step-by-step explanation:

distance = [tex]\sqrt{(8-9)^{2} +(3-0)^{2} }[/tex]

=[tex]\sqrt{1^{2}  +3^{2} }[/tex]

=[tex]\sqrt{1+9}[/tex]

=[tex]\sqrt{10}[/tex]

=3.16
